Barry White

Barry White, an American singer-songwriter and producer, was a central figure in soul music during the 1970s. His distinctive bass-baritone voice and romantic image established him as a symbol of seductive songcraft, with hits like "Can't Get Enough of Your Love, Babe" and "You're the First, the Last, My Everything". White's distinctive sound, characterized by lush orchestral arrangements and smooth soulful vocals, had a significant influence on the disco genre. His career spanned over three decades, earning him two Grammy Awards and induction into the Dance Music Hall of Fame.
